Kanada, Fukuoka
Kanada (金田町 Kanada-machi) was a town located in Tagawa District, Fukuoka Prefecture, Japan. As of 2003, the town had an estimated population of 8,285 and a density of 1,110.59 persons per km². The total area was 7.46 km². On March 6, 2006, Kanada was merged with the towns of Akaike and Hōjō (all from Tagawa District) to create the town of Fukuchi.
